Practice putting all of your attention on the other person during a conversation. Sit still. See how long you can sit in the chair without moving or looking away from the wall. Ignore them. They will move to a different part of the body soon enough.

How long can you last? Follow the second hand of an analog clock. Watch the second hand of a clock go around and around. How long can you watch the clock without thinking about something else?

When your mind wanders, bring it back to the clock. Is it boring? Of course. Suggestion: focus on the tip of the moving second hand. Count backward from Count backward by ones. Then try counting backward by seven or any other number that appeals to you. How far can you get before your mind drifts away?

You might strengthen your math skills, too. I personally do this one for sleep relaxation sometimes. Focus on your breathing. Put your focus on your breath and keep it there. See how many breaths or minutes you can maintain your awareness on your breathing before you catch yourself thinking about something else.

This is one of the most common meditation practices. Listen to instrumental music and try to keep your attention on the music. Without lyrics to help keep your brain engaged, your mind will start daydreaming very quickly.

Focus on the notes, the flow, the tempo, or the feeling. Few people can truly concentrate well. You have a huge advantage if you can develop this important skill. Focus and concentration require practice.

Understanding the Impact of ADHD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der that is commonly identified in childhood and often continues into adulthood. Although ADHD manifests differently in individuals, some common key characteristics of ADHD include: Inattention : Individuals with ADHD may have trouble staying focused, following through on instructions, and may be easily distracted.

They often find it hard to organize tasks and activities and might frequently forget about daily activities. Hyperactivity : This involves excessive movement or fidgeting, a feeling of restlessness, and difficulty staying seated or being quiet when required.

In adults, this might manifest as constant activity or an inability to relax. Impulsivity : This includes making hasty actions without considering potential consequences, having a desire for immediate rewards, and interrupting others.

The Science of Brain Training Brain training, also known as cognitive training, refers to a range of activities and exercises designed to improve specific brain functions, including memory, concentration, problem-solving, processing speed, and decision-making. One simple practice is to focus on your breathing. Just that. Breathe in, breathe out. Try this for five to fifteen minutes doing that each day. Doing this meditation is a great way to practice both focus and metacognition becoming aware of your thought processes.

It also helps reduce stress and prevent burnout. As they get into this practice, most people find their mind is in fact an incredibly noisy and distracting place. The meditation usually goes something like this:. The real value is in noticing every time your mind wanders, and then bringing your attention back to your breathing.

This type of meditation builds mental focus in the same way that doing push-ups builds arm strength. Most people who try this for the first time are astonished at how hard it is to focus on just one thing for more than ten seconds.

Over time, though, it becomes a rewarding and relaxing exercise, and, like fitness, has spillover benefits into every other aspect of your life. Memorization is cognitively taxing. Reading of any kind is beneficial. Although almost all of us read in our daily lives, the average person consumes mostly easy-to-read short-form content. To develop focus, pick up something long and dense. Meet the elite athletes making time to hit the books 3 min read.

Read Story. The more repetitive the task, the harder it will be to concentrate, and the more it will strengthen focus. Practicing everyday, repetitive tasks such as opening and closing your hand for five minutes will help train the mind to focus on command.

Active listening develops focus and is a vital tool in strengthening our relationships with others. While it's tempting to scroll on social media, or do work while listening to a podcast or an audiobook, sitting still and focusing entirely on audio content, whether it's a friend talking or a movie, will help hone that ability to focus.

Staying on task can be difficult, but it can be particularly challenging when you are surrounded by constant distractions. In today's always-connected world, diversions are nothing more than a click away, which makes it that much more difficult to figure out how to focus. Even during quiet moments, distraction is literally at your fingertips as you find yourself checking your social media notifications or the latest news updates. But being mentally focused is essential for success.
